Correctly manage the lifecycle of IME InputChannels.
InputChannels are normally duplicated when sent to a remote process over Binder but this does not happen if the recipient is running within the system server process. This causes problems for KeyGuard because the InputMethodManagerService may accidentally dispose the channel that KeyGuard is using. Fixed the lifecycle of InputChannels that are managed by the IME framework. We now return a duplicate of the channel to the application and then take care to dispose of the duplicate when necessary. In particular, InputBindResult disposes its InputChannel automatically when returned through Binder (using PARCELABLE_WRITE_RETURN_VALUE).
